OLEOLOGY’s expertise in water treatment systems (incorporating MyCelx technology) offers advanced solutions to enable recycling and decontaminating water quicker, simpler, and more cost-effective. MyCelx technology efficiently removes organics, oils, hydrocarbons, mercury and PFAS to below detectable levels.
MyCelx technology is utilised by some of the TOP 500 companies for water treatment around the world. OLEOLOGY’s solution is a small footprint able to remove free oil, dispersed and emulsified hydrocarbons to environment, well below EPA requirements.
While other oil water separators (OWS) rely on mechanical separation or chemicals, MyCelx actually bonds with oil and other contaminants at a molecular level. This means oils, hydrocarbons, and other contaminants are removed almost completely without any water loss. Some of MyCelx’s many benefits are:

Groundwater remediation, as the name suggests, is the process of identifying and fixing groundwater problems, usually pollution or other contaminants. In some cases, groundwater remediation is the only way to solve potentially destructive environmental and health problems for whole communities.
